A computer hardware company delivering world-class, precision-engineered data solutions. Our client helps to maximize humanity’s potential by providing top-notch, precision-engineered data solutions.
We’re looking for a motivated and proactive Automation QA Engineer with Python skills, ready to take part in building a great product with us.
As an Automation QA Engineer on this project, you will be responsible for developing and maintaining automation tests for web cloud solutions, ensuring the quality and reliability of our products. You will communicate directly with the client and the client’s engineering team to impact the QA team’s performance.
- 4+ years of experience in software testing
- 2+ years of experience in automation testing
- Strong Python programming skills
- Experience with automation testing tools and frameworks (e.g., Selenium, PyTest, or similar)
- Experience in testing back-end systems and databases
- Understanding of web technologies (HTML, CSS, JavaScript) and web testing
- Familiarity with CI/CD tools and processes
- Experience with cloud solutions (e.g., AWS, Azure, Google Cloud) is a plus
- At least intermediate English level (both written and spoken)
- Excellent communication skills and ability to work collaboratively in a team environment
- Develop and maintain automation tests for web cloud solutions to ensure product quality
- Perform functional, integration, and performance testing of the back-end system
- Analyze test results, identify issues, and report bugs clearly and effectively
- Collaborate with developers to troubleshoot and resolve issues in back-end systems
- Contribute to the continuous improvement of testing frameworks and automation solutions
- Attend meetings with the client and the team